Shaping techniques in dog training offer several benefits. They enable trainers To break down behaviors into smaller, achievable steps, promoting better understanding & learning for dogs. These methods can be highly effective in teaching complex tasks & shaping desired behaviors. Additionally, shaping techniques reinforce problem-solving skills & help build a strong bond between dogs & their trainers. However, there are some drawbacks To consider. Shaping can be time-consuming & requires patience from both The trainer & The dog. It may not be suitable for dogs with fear or aggression issues, as it could potentially exacerbate their behavior. Dog training at Petco can vary in cost depending on The type of program you choose. On average, group classes can range from $100 To $200 for a 6-week course, while private sessions can cost around $150 To $300 per hour. Petco also offers a 6-week course specifically for puppies, which usually costs around $125 To $150. Additionally, there are specialized training programs available for issues such as aggression or anxiety, with prices varying based on The specific needs of your dog. The average cost of dog training per hour can range from $30 To $150, depending on The location, type of training, & trainer’s experience. Basic obedience training often falls on The lower end of The scale, while specialized training or advanced behavior modification can be more expensive. Factors like group classes versus private sessions & The reputation of The trainer can also influence The cost. The cost of dog training in India can vary depending on various factors such as The location, duration of The training program, training methods used, & The trainer’s experience & reputation. On average, basic obedience training for a dog in India can range from ₹2000 To ₹6000 per month, while more comprehensive programs like agility training or behavior modification can cost upwards of ₹10,000 or more. Using a clicker for dog training can be an effective method. The pros include its simplicity, clear communication with The dog, & quick association with rewards. It can also be used for various types of training, including basic commands & complex tricks. However, there are some cons To consider. It requires timing & coordination, which may be difficult for some owners. Additionally, The sound of The clicker may not be suitable for all dogs, & it can be easily lost or forgotten.
